How can I give preference to OSPF interarea routes over intra-area routes?

0
10

A. According to section 11 of RFC 2328 , the order of preference for OSPF routes is: • intra-area routes, O • interarea routes, O IA • external routes type 1, O E1 • external routes type 2, O E2 This rule of preference cannot be changed. However, it applies only within a single OSPF process. If a router is running more than one OSPF process, route comparison occurs. With route comparison, the metrics and administrative distances (if they have been changed) of the OSPF processes are compared. Route types are disregarded when routes supplied by two different OSPF processes are compared.
